Pros

If you show up for work you will keep yout job. Intermountain doesn't fire people very often. reliable paycheck Good medical insurance and you can get lots of experience

Cons

Ive seen many employees that deserved to be fired for actions but they never were. Mark harrison, the new CEO treats IHC like a for profit hospital. in the nearly 8 years i have been with IHC i have seen more layoffs in the last 2 years than ever before. IHC is about 20% behind the U on how they pay their employees. The expectations are very high and IHC wants to have as few employees possible to get the job done. This makes it very demanding on employees and tough to maintain forever.
